Hymns and Prayers for Use at the Marriage of Roger Antony Horby and Veronica Blackwood at St Paul's Church, Knightsbridge. December xvii, mcmxxxi. 8vo, 215 X 155mm, [8]p, [printer unknown, but NOT ASHENDENE PRESS], n.d. (1931).

Set in Centaur and Arrighi Italic and printed in red and black on specially watermarked handmade paper. Blue printed wrappers, sewn with silk thread. A fine copy.

The marriage service of C.H. St John Hornby's second son presents something of a puzzle. Though not recorded by Franklin, or listed in the bibliography, it was produced - and well produced - as an imitation of the Order of Service for his first son's wedding in 1928. There is, however, no known instance of the use of these typefaces at the Ashendene Press at it was certainly printed elsewhere - but why?
